## Restock Planner Setup

Welcome to the Cartwheel restock planner team. The planner generates daily routes for vending-machine refills across the Halbrook campus. As a contractor, you deploy only to the staging fleet. Builds must be signed before the kiosks will accept them. Once your environment is configured, add the deploy key shown below to your agent.

deploy key for kawip-yajef: bky13_3Ar26RfYwhUJD

## Configuration

Welcome to LiftSim Orrel. Before running the dispatcher simulation, copy `env.sample` to `.env` in the project root. Set `SIM_FLOORS` (integer, 2–120), `SIM_CARS` (number of elevator cars), and `SIM_TICK_MS` (simulation step interval; 50 is a sensible default). Leave `SIM_SEED` unset unless you need reproducible passenger arrival patterns. Results are streamed to the Pellwick metrics endpoint, which requires authentication. Add the metrics access token on the line immediately following this section.

secret setting of yafof-tawep: RELAY_SECRET8=8abb5772

## Support

The Palissade consent banner rollout is staged by region; current status lives in the rollout tracker. Config changes ship via the Nimbright CDN and take ~15 minutes to propagate. Do not hotfix banner copy directly — legal must approve wording. Rollout blockers get raised at the weekly eng sync. For urgent issues between syncs, contact the rollout owners at the address below.

escalation mailbox, yajeg-bageg: quenax.olidor@lumiccorp.internal